About OSHA Records

OSHA records document the results of federal workplace safety inspections. These public records include information about the employer, the inspection circumstances, any standards violated, and the penalties proposed or assessed.

The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970 gives workers the right to a safe workplace. OSHA carries out this mandate through inspections, standard-setting, and compliance assistance programs available to employers of all sizes.

About This Industry

NAICS 237110: Utility System Construction / Construction

This industry comprises establishments primarily engaged in the construction of water and sewer lines, pipelines, power and communication lines, and related structures such as pumping stations and transformer stations.

Common workplace hazards include trench cave-ins during underground utility installation, electrocution from contact with live electrical systems, and struck-by incidents from excavation equipment. Workers may also face risks from traffic exposure in roadway work zones and confined space entry in manholes.
